Understanding Synthetic Cannabinoids
Synthetic cannabinoids are a group of chemicals designed to bind to the same cannabinoid receptors in the brain as THC. These receptors, part of the body’s endocannabinoid system, regulate a variety of physiological processes, including mood, appetite, and memory. Synthetic cannabinoids, however, can be much more potent than natural cannabis, sometimes producing effects that are stronger, more unpredictable, and far more harmful.
Unlike marijuana, which has been studied for decades, synthetic cannabinoids are produced in clandestine laboratories, and their chemical composition can vary greatly between batches. As a result, the effects of synthetic cannabinoids are not only inconsistent but can also lead to serious health risks, including psychosis. The unpredictability of these substances makes them particularly dangerous for users, especially those with no prior experience with drug use.
How Synthetic Cannabinoids Induce Psychosis
The mechanism by which synthetic cannabinoids induce psychosis involves the overstimulation of the brain’s cannabinoid receptors. These substances are designed to bind more strongly to these receptors than natural THC, causing a much more intense and often harmful effect.
In many cases, this overstimulation can lead to alterations in perception, thought processes, and emotional regulation, which are the hallmark symptoms of psychosis.
When the cannabinoid receptors are overstimulated, the brain’s normal functioning is disrupted, leading to hallucinations, delusions, and confusion. Some users may experience feelings of paranoia, where they perceive threats or dangers that are not present.
Others may exhibit erratic or violent behavior as their thoughts become disjointed and difficult to control. These symptoms can be frightening for the individual and those around them, often resulting in the need for immediate medical intervention.
Risk Factors for Developing Psychosis
Not everyone who uses synthetic cannabinoids will develop a psychotic disorder, but several risk factors can increase an individual’s likelihood of experiencing these effects. Genetics plays a significant role; individuals with a family history of mental health disorders, particularly psychotic illnesses like schizophrenia, may be more susceptible to the psychosis-inducing effects of synthetic cannabinoids.
Other factors include pre-existing mental health conditions, such as anxiety, depression, or bipolar disorder, which may be exacerbated by the use of synthetic cannabinoids. Additionally, the frequency and quantity of use are important determinants of the severity of symptoms. Regular or high-dose users are at a higher risk of developing psychotic disorders, as their brain chemistry is continually disrupted by these potent substances.
Symptoms of Psychosis Induced by Synthetic Cannabinoids
The symptoms of psychosis induced by synthetic cannabinoids can vary greatly depending on the individual and the specific substance used. Common symptoms include hallucinations, where users see or hear things that are not real, and delusions, which are false beliefs that are not based in reality. For instance, a person may believe they are being followed or persecuted, a condition known as paranoid delusion.
In addition to these cognitive symptoms, individuals may experience severe mood disturbances, such as extreme anxiety or agitation. Some users may act out aggressively or engage in risky behaviors due to a distorted sense of reality. Physical symptoms, such as rapid heart rate, sweating, and dizziness, are also common. These symptoms can be debilitating, and in severe cases, they may require hospitalization to ensure the safety of the individual and others.
The Long-Term Effects of Synthetic Cannabinoid-Induced Psychosis
While many cases of synthetic cannabinoid-induced psychosis are temporary and resolve once the substance leaves the system, some individuals may experience long-lasting effects. These can include persistent anxiety, depression, and memory problems, which can significantly impact the individual’s quality of life. In some cases, psychosis may trigger or worsen underlying mental health disorders, leading to chronic psychiatric issues.
Long-term use of synthetic cannabinoids can also lead to physical dependence, where users feel compelled to continue using the substance despite the negative effects on their mental and physical health.
This dependence can exacerbate psychotic symptoms, creating a vicious cycle that is difficult to break without professional intervention. Furthermore, repeated exposure to synthetic cannabinoids may lead to lasting changes in brain function, increasing the risk of developing more severe psychiatric conditions.
Treatment for Psychosis Induced by Synthetic Cannabinoids
Treatment for psychosis caused by synthetic cannabinoids typically involves managing symptoms and addressing any underlying mental health issues. The first step in treatment is to ensure the individual is safe and stabilized, particularly if they are experiencing aggressive behavior or extreme agitation. In some cases, hospitalization may be necessary to monitor the individual and prevent harm to themselves or others.
Antipsychotic medications are commonly prescribed to help manage the symptoms of psychosis, particularly hallucinations and delusions. These medications work by altering the brain’s chemical balance, helping to restore normal thought processes.
In addition to medication, therapy, such as cognitive-behavioral therapy (CBT), can be beneficial for addressing the psychological effects of psychosis and helping the individual cope with any long-term consequences.
For individuals who have developed a dependency on synthetic cannabinoids, rehabilitation programs may be necessary to help them detoxify and overcome their addiction. Support groups and counseling can also play a crucial role in the recovery process, offering emotional support and guidance for those struggling with substance use disorders.
